Definition of antecedent:

(adj) : earlier either in time or order
(n) : any thing that precedes another thing, especially the cause of the second thing; one's ancestors
"in "The policeman asked the boy what he was doing" the phrase "the boy" is the antecedent of the pronoun "he"."
